Criminal Prosperity - Drug Trafficking, Money Laundering and Financial Crisis after the Cold War (Hardcover): Guilhem Fabre Criminal Prosperity - Drug Trafficking, Money Laundering and Financial Crisis after the Cold War (Hardcover)
Guilhem Fabre
R3,969 Discovery Miles 39 690 Ships in 12 - 17 working days


Drug trafficking is the most visible part of the profits of organized crime, which have grown considerably since the end of the cold war. The mirror of history shows us the impact of the drug trade in the colonization of Asia. The post cold war geopolitical context reproduces elements of the past, with new opportunities for drug trafficking in the globalization process, as can be seen in the example of China, and the lasting impunity in terms of money laundering. With the growing role of offshore locations in the global financial system, criminal prosperity has even affected the economic stability of some countries. This book presents a new and heterodox interpretation of the post cold war financial crisis, by focusing on the unexplored dimension of illicit actors.
The Mexican crisis of 1994 and its 'tequila effect' is analyzed as a model of a 'cocaine effect' from the local laundering of profits from the sale of drugs in the US. The Japanese crisis of the 1990s is put in relation to the economic influence of the Yakuza on the real estate bubble, which had the effect of postponing necessary market adjustments. And the Thai crisis of 1997 is analyzed in the light of massive money laundering of institutional and criminal networks, whose undeclared profits represent about 10% of GDP.

Soils as a Key Component of the Critical Zone 4 - Soils and Water Quality (Hardcover): Guilhem Bourrie Soils as a Key Component of the Critical Zone 4 - Soils and Water Quality (Hardcover)
Guilhem Bourrie
R3,806 Discovery Miles 38 060 Ships in 12 - 17 working days

This book provides the most up-to-date knowledge on water in soils and applications for the best use of our water resources. It first addresses the influence of soils on water quality, which is linked to rock weathering, soil formation, acidity and waterlogging. Here, the constituents of soils - such as clay minerals and iron oxides - play a major role. These modifications also have an impact on biogeochemical processes at the global scale, including the carbon cycle and the composition of the atmosphere. Secondly, this book discusses soil salinity, alkalinity and sodification in climates spanning from Mediterranean to arid. Here, water quality results from the concentration of solutes by evaporation and the transpiration of plants. The proper management of irrigation both protects soils against acidification and ensures sustainable agroecological development, while improper management leads to soil degradation and groundwater overexploitation. Lastly, the book describes how excess transfer of phosphorus in lakes results from a cascade of liberation and immobilization in the structure of the surrounding landscape. This leads to a general integrative method to limit eutrophication and restore the quality of water bodies.

Anglo-Gascon Aquitaine: Problems and Perspectives (Hardcover): Guilhem Pepin Anglo-Gascon Aquitaine: Problems and Perspectives (Hardcover)
Guilhem Pepin; Contributions by Andy King, Covadonga Valdaliso, Francoise Laine, Frederic Boutoulle, …
R2,236 Discovery Miles 22 360 Ships in 12 - 17 working days

The political union between England and Gascony or Aquitaine lasted from the early thirteenth century until 1453, and the long series of Gascon Rolls in the National Archives record some of the business of Aquitaine during the union. These are currently being calendared, and this volume reflects some of the research which resulted, both on the administration and record production of the Anglo-Gascon officials, and the English government of the region.

Journal of Medieval Military History - Volume IX: Soldiers, Weapons and Armies in the Fifteenth Century (Hardcover, New): Anne... Journal of Medieval Military History - Volume IX: Soldiers, Weapons and Armies in the Fifteenth Century (Hardcover, New)
Anne Curry, Adrian R. Bell; Contributions by Adam Chapman, Andreas Remy, Andy King, …
R2,231 Discovery Miles 22 310 Ships in 12 - 17 working days

Special edition of a volume which has become the leading forum for debate on aspects of medieval warfare, looking at warfare in the fifteenth century. The articles in this volume focus on the fifteenth century. Several draw on the substantial archives of the Burgundian polity, focusing particularly on the Flemish shooting guilds, spying, and the provision of troops by towns. Theurban emphasis continues with a study of the transition from "traditional" artillery to gunpowder weaponry in Southampton, and a comparison of descriptions of military engagements in the London Chronicles and in Swiss town chronicles. Welsh chronicling of the battle of Edgecote (1469) is also reviewed, and there is a re-assessment of Welsh involvement in the Agincourt campaign. English interests in France are pursued in two further papers, one consideringthe personnel of the ordnance companies in Lancastrian Normandy and the other examining the little-known French attacks on Gascony in the early years of the fifteenth century. Bouchardon - Royal Artist of the Enlightenment (Hardcover): Edouard Kopp, Guilhem Scherf, Anne-Lise Desmas, Juliette Trey Bouchardon - Royal Artist of the Enlightenment (Hardcover)
Edouard Kopp, Guilhem Scherf, Anne-Lise Desmas, Juliette Trey
R2,143 Discovery Miles 21 430 Ships in 12 - 17 working days

One of the most imaginative and fascinating artists of eighteenth-century France, Edme Bouchardon (1698-1762) was instrumental in the transition from Rococo to Neoclassicism and in the artistic rediscovery of classical antiquity. Much celebrated in his time, Bouchardon created some of the most iconic images of the age of Louis XV. His oeuvre demonstrates a remarkable variety of themes (from copies after the antique to subjects of history and mythology, portraiture, anatomical studies, ornament, fountains and tombs), media (drawings, sculptures, medals, prints), and techniques (chalk, plaster, wax, terracotta, marble, bronze). This lavishly illustrated publication represents an unprecedented and thorough survey on this major and unique artist from the Age of Enlightenment, offering in-depth scholarship based on unpublished material detailing the subtle relationship between, as well as the relative autonomy of, the artist's two careers as a sculptor and a draftsman.
